043 CREATIVE WRITING/JOURNALISM
0.5 credit | Grades: 101112
This course, open to tenth, eleventh, and twelfth graders, will further the student's ability to report and write the news for the school newspaper, for local papers, and digital media, such as edublogs and e-magazines. Emphasis will be placed upon interviewing techniques, organization of facts, and writing feature articles. Newspaper production work will be included. Students will also have opportunities to write short stories, poetry, and one act plays for the literary magazine.
